What is the meaning of "--" spam score?
-
The "--" spam score indicates that Moz's system couldn't determine the spam score for the specific site. This could happen due to insufficient data or other technical issues.
To check the spam score, you can visit Moz.com and use their tools to get a detailed analysis of your website’s spam score. This score helps identify potentially harmful links and practices that might affect your site's SEO performance.

Very simple: It's just not available for that site. It basically means that the site is not in the index from Moz.
